html {
    font-size: 1rem;
    /* width: 100%;
    height:7rem;
    overflow: hidden; */
  }
  body{
    width: 100%;
    height:7rem;
    overflow: hidden;
    background: #65A583;
  }
  html, body, p, h1, h2, h3, h4, a, ul, li, img {
    margin: 0;
    padding: 0;
    list-style: none;
    text-decoration: none;
    color: black;
    font-family: "Microsoft YaHei UI";
  }
  a{
    color: #FFF
  }
  img, a {
    display: block;
  }

  :root{
    --swiper-theme-color: #0070b0;
  }
  .mt-15 {
    margin-top: 0.16rem;
  }
  
  .pd-15 {
    padding: 0.15rem;
  }
  ::-webkit-scrollbar {
    display: none;
  }
  body {
    max-width: 6.4rem;
    margin: 0 auto;
    width: 100%;
    height: 100%;
    font-size: 0.16rem;
  }

  .bg{
    width: 100%;
    height: 100%;
    background-repeat: no-repeat;
    background-size: 100%;
  }
  .main{
    width: 100%;
    height: 100%;
    position: relative;
    transition: all ease 3s;
  }
  .warp{
    background-image: url(../img/0102bg.jpg);
  }
  .com{
    width: 90%;
    margin: 0 auto;
    padding: .2rem 0;
    position: relative;
    padding-bottom: 0;
  }
  
  .warp ul li:nth-child(1) img{
    width: 1.7rem;
    height: .3rem;
    margin: .24rem auto;
  }
  .warp ul li:nth-child(2) img{
    width: 2.6rem;
    height: .6rem;
    margin: 0 auto;
  }
  .warp ul li:nth-child(3) img{
    width: 2.9rem;
    height: 2.9rem;
    margin: .3rem auto 0 auto;
  }
  .warp ul li:nth-child(3) p{
    width: 2.4rem;
    height: 2.4rem;
    margin: .3rem auto 0.5rem auto;
    font-size:0.14rem;
    line-height:1.5;
    color:#67A686;
  }
  .warp ul li:nth-child(4) img{
    width: .8rem;
    height: 2.3rem;
    position: relative;
    left: .18rem;
    top: -.2rem;
  }
  /* 修改-- */
  /* .warp ul li:nth-child(5) img{
    width: 1.8rem;
    height: 2.7rem;
    margin: 0 auto;
  } */
  /* .warp ul li:nth-child(5){
    position: absolute;
    left: .8rem;
    bottom: 0rem;
  } */
  /* .warp ul li:nth-child(6) img{
    width: .8rem;
    height: .8rem;
    margin: 0 auto;
  }
  .warp ul li:nth-child(6){
    position: absolute;
    bottom: .2rem;
    left: 1.3rem;
  } */
  /* --修改 */

  .warp2{
    background-image: url(../img/03zzbg.jpg);
  }
  .cityName img{
    width: 3.3rem;
    height: .8rem;
    margin: 0 auto;
    margin-bottom: .2rem;
  }
  .zzCity #chose{
    background-image: url(../img/03chose.png);
  }
  /* 添加------------ */

  /* -------------添加 */
  .zzCity li{
    display: inline-block;
    background-image: url(../img/03cityBtn.png);
    background-size: 100%;
    background-repeat: no-repeat;
    width: .63rem;
    height: .2rem;
    text-align: center;
    line-height: .2rem;
    color: #ffffff;
    /* padding: .1rem .2rem; */
    font-size: .1rem;
  }
  .zzCity li:nth-child(4){
    margin-right: .2rem;
  }
  .zzCity{
    margin-bottom: .2rem;
  }
  .newsImg img{
    width: 3.3rem;
    height: 1.93rem;
    margin: 0 auto;
  }
  .newsImg iframe{
    width: 3.3rem;
    height: 1.93rem;
    margin: 0 auto;
    /* display: none; */
    border-radius: 10px;
  }
  .text{
    width: 85%;
    margin: 0 auto;
    background-color: #347A93;
    border-radius: 0 0 .1rem .1rem;
  }
  .text p{
    color: #ffffff;
    width: 90%;
    margin: 0 auto;
    padding: .1rem 0;
  }
  .text p:nth-child(1){
    font-size: .15rem;
    line-height: .26rem;
  }
  .text p:nth-child(3){
    font-size: .1rem;
    line-height: .15rem;
    height: 1.35rem;
  }
  .active img{
    display: inline-block;
  }
  /* 修改-- */
  .active img:nth-child(1),
  .active img:nth-child(2){
    width: 0.6rem;
    height: 0.6rem;
    margin-bottom: .4rem;
  }
    /* --修改 */
  .active img:nth-child(1){
    margin-left: .3rem;
  }
  .active img:nth-child(2){
    margin-left: 1.6rem;
  }
  /* 修改-- */
  /* .active img:nth-child(2){
    width: 1rem;
    height: 1.57rem;
    margin-top: -.1rem;
    margin-left: .3rem;
    margin-right: .2rem;
  } */
  /* --修改 */
  .warp3{
    background-image: url(../img/04kfbg.jpg);
  }
  .kf .cityName,
  .kf .text,
  .pds .cityName,
  .pds .text,
  .xx .cityName,
  .xx .text,
  .lh .cityName,
  .lh .text,
  .jy .cityName,
  .jy .text,
  .ny .text,
  .py .text{
    margin-bottom: .4rem;
  }

  .warp4{
    background-image: url(../img/05pdsbg.jpg);
  }
  .warp5{
    background-image: url(../img/06xxbg.jpg);
  }
  .warp6{
    background-image: url(../img/07pybg.jpg);
  }
  .pyCity,
  .nyCity{
    margin-bottom: .3rem;
    text-align: center;
  }
  .pyCity #chose{
    background-image: url(../img/07chose.png);
  }
  .pyCity li,
  .nyCity li{
    display: inline-block;
    background-image: url(../img/07cityBtn.png);
    background-size: 100%;
    background-repeat: no-repeat;
    width: .63rem;
    height: .2rem;
    text-align: center;
    line-height: .2rem;
    color: #ffffff;
    /* padding: .1rem .2rem; */
    font-size: .1rem;
  }

  .warp7{
    background-image: url(../img/08lhbg.jpg);
  }
  .warp8{
    background-image: url(../img/09nybg.jpg);
  }
  .nyCity{
    display: flex;
    justify-content: space-between;
  }
  .nyCity #chose{
    background-image: url(../img/09chose.png); 
  }
  .nyCity li{
    background-image: url(../img/09cityBtn.png);
    width: .73rem;
  }

  .warp9{
    background-image: url(../img/10jybg.jpg);
  }
  /* .hide{
    display: none
  } */


  /* 添加--- */
  .startBtn{
    width: 0.9rem!important;
    height: 0.9rem!important;
    position: absolute;
    bottom: 0.2rem;
    left: 50%;
    transform: translate(-50%,0);
    z-index:199
    
  }
  .startBtn img{
    width: 0.9rem!important;
    height: 0.9rem!important;
    z-index: 199;
  }

  .sportiveBoy{
    width: 1.8rem;
    height: 2.7rem;
    transition: all ease 3s;
    top: 4.2rem;
    left: 50%;
    transform: translate(-50%,0);
    position: absolute;
  }

  .zzCity .on{
    background-image: url(../img/03chose.png);
  }
  .zzCityNews {
    margin-bottom: 0.4rem;
  }
  .zzCityNews div{
    display: none;
  }
  .zzCityNews div.on{
    display: block;
  }

  .pyCity .on{
    background-image: url(../img/07chose.png);
  }
  .pyCityNews {
    margin-bottom: 0.4rem;
  }
  .pyCityNews div{
    display: none;
  }
  .pyCityNews div.on{
    display: block;
  }

  .nyCity .on{
    background-image: url(../img/07chose.png);
  }
  .nyCityNews {
    margin-bottom: 0.4rem;
  }
  .nyCityNews div{
    display: none;
  }
  .nyCityNews div.on{
    display: block;
  }
  /* ----添加 */